Needless to say the fishing is unreal right now! We had over 55 pounds in two days and didn’t make the top 5. Actually took 8th. Crazy to think that these types of weights came in especially during the dog days of summer. We found a really good jig rap bite up shallow. It was a big fish program and big fish we caught. No surprise here but the best color jig raps, shiver minnows, puppet minnows were any variation of white. We all know the walleyes are chasing smelt but they were also keying in on white bass. Kind of interesting to see. We also caught some really nice fish on the old school Lindy rig with a minnow during the event. I wasn’t able to track down any creek chubs before the tournament unfortunately but I would have to believe those would have done great! Slow death rigs in shallower water, and also out deep was still really good, and we had found some awesome fish, maybe not tournament fish, but great guide fish with big fish mixed in. We had to make a choice to fish community seas because of the average size of fish, plus I felt I had found a concentration of fish that other anglers were not targeting. Our plan seemed to be in check right away day one, but soon after we had a few fish the gig was up. Again, to see the quality of fish that were caught on this amazing body of water was literally head shaking.
